Trump Criticizes Handling of Ukraine Conflict, Blames Leaders for Prolonged War

 


US President Donald Trump recently expressed deep concern over the ongoing conflict between Russia and Ukraine, highlighting the severe human cost. Speaking at a NATO summit in the Netherlands, Trump remarked, "Last week, they lost 7,000 soldiers. That should have never happened." He emphasized that the conflict, which has resulted in thousands of casualties, could have been avoided entirely.¹


*Key Points from Trump's Statement:*


- *Avoidable Conflict*: Trump believes the conflict could have been avoided with stronger diplomacy and deterrence.

- *Criticism of Past Administrations*: He criticized past administrations and international actors for failing to take decisive action earlier.

- *Importance of NATO*: Trump stressed the need for all NATO member nations to meet their financial and military commitments.

- *Increased Defense Spending*: He advocated for increased defense spending across the alliance to serve as a deterrent against future aggression.


Trump's comments reflect his consistent position on avoiding prolonged conflicts and reinforcing American strength through deterrence and preparedness. However, his stance on the Ukraine conflict has been met with criticism, with some arguing that his approach would only exacerbate the situation.
